Well it does depend what you are looking for? High thc? High cbd? 1 to 1? Depends on your condition however i have ordered across the board from the LP s i have tried and i am the most impressed with canna farms and their products. Very good strains great tastes and decent prices. Shipping is 17 and change for purolator or express post so i use purolator. From BC to my house in northern ontario is 2 days. If it ships wednesday afternoon, friday its at my door. They always have lots of stock as well. I have never had a hard time ordering the strains i need.
 
No problem you can also get a grow at home license as well i have mine quite a few do. Its easy enough and in the end growing your own is way better

I second everyones suggestion to get your grow license asap because even with amateur skills you can produce better bud with all the kief still attached than the majority of LPs. But, until you do, the one I would recommend is Broken Coast Cannabis in BC for flower. Their prices aren't cheap but the quality is as high as the best cannabis I've had from other sources. I've tried strains from Mettrum, Tweed, Aurora and a few others but broken coast god kush, master kush, sour og strains and their 1:1 cbd strain are great. Aurora would be a second choice for those who are on a budget. Good quality with compassion pricing for those who qualify.

I don't order regularly because the prices are so high with no discounts for bulk orders which is how I'm used to purchasing cannabis. It's helpful to have the bottle from an LP and then fill it with other strains so you have a "prescription" on you at all times and cops can't hassle you for it.

I've used Tweed's oils for both pain relief and insomnia but now that I know how to make my own oil, I never buy theirs anymore as it's just too expensive, in my opinion. And, besides that, Tweed strips the terpenes from their oils, which I don't like as I know terpenes are like vitamins and are good for you.

As for seeds, you can order seeds from lots of marijuana seedbanks. Crop King is a favourite Canadian seed store. Heck, you can probably even get some at a local head shop.

If you follow the ACMPR you can only buy starting materials from LP s. However its pretty hard when theres only a few that sell seeds. I managed to get seeds from tweed. OG kush and CBD kush seeds. Will start them in a week so we shall see how they go.
 
Make sure to do your research when dealing with LP's there's been a lot of sketchy stuff happen with recalls and use of banned pesticides ect.
